Heim offers a relaxed, enjoyable burger spot with good ingredients and a lively street-side setting. The burgers are juicy and full of flavor, though they could stand out even more with a bit more creativity in the seasoning or sauces. The fries were excellent — crisp, golden, and easily one of the best parts of the meal. Their Pepsi-based drinks come in generous portions and are surprisingly refreshing, adding a fun touch overall. The outdoor seating creates a cozy, casual vibe, but it’s worth noting that it may not be the most comfortable option on colder fall or winter evenings. All in all, Heim is a solid choice if you’re looking for a casual place with good food and a friendly atmosphere. The fries and drinks alone make it worth trying — and with a few small improvements to the flavors, it could become one of the standout burger spots in town. Burgerheim is one of those spots that stands out immediately—not because it’s trying too hard, but because it feels authentic. From the moment you step up to its street-style counter, you know you’re about to get something that’s been made with care. The design is casual and urban, with an open view of the grill and the smell of sizzling beef filling the air. It’s not a fancy restaurant and doesn’t pretend to be one; it’s a burger joint that takes its craft seriously. Let’s start with the food, because that’s what matters most. The burgers are excellent. Each one feels thoughtfully made: fresh ingredients, soft buns, and beef that’s cooked just right—juicy, smoky, and flavorful without being greasy. You can tell they pay attention to quality. The toppings taste fresh and balanced; even the cheese and sauces complement the burger instead of overpowering it. The fries are crisp and well-seasoned, and the portion sizes are generous enough for a full meal without feeling overstuffed. Everything about the plate says “premium street food” done right. Is it a bit overpriced? Yes, slightly. You’ll probably pay a few more dollars than you would at other burger places in town. But once you bite into it, you understand why. The difference in quality is clear: better meat, fresher bread, cleaner cooking oil, and more consistent flavor. It’s the kind of place where you pay for quality and care rather than quantity or gimmicks. If you’re after a cheap fast-food burger, this isn’t it. If you want something that feels handcrafted, Burgerheim delivers. What really adds to the experience is the staff. Everyone here seems genuinely happy to be doing their job. They’re friendly, quick to help, and always up for a small conversation. That kind of warmth makes a big difference, especially in a casual dining place. Even when it’s busy, the service feels personal. The team moves efficiently but never rushes you. There’s an easy vibe between the cooks, the servers, and the customers that makes the shop feel like part of the neighborhood rather than just another restaurant. The setting fits the concept perfectly: open, vibrant, and down-to-earth. The street-style shop front gives it an approachable charm. You can grab your food and sit by the counter, or just watch people walking by while eating. The music, the atmosphere, and the steady hum of the grill create a simple but satisfying experience that’s hard to find elsewhere. Overall, Burgerheim strikes a fine balance between casual street food and premium quality. It’s not cheap, but it’s worth what you pay. The flavors are clean and memorable, the staff are lovely, and the whole place feels built around genuine passion for good burgers. If you love real, well-made burgers and don’t mind paying a bit extra for something you’ll actually enjoy from first bite to last, Burgerheim is a must-try.
